Game summary
Jamal Murray started vs San Antonio Spurs and finished with 2 points, 1 rebound, and 2 assists in 23 minutes during the January 13, 2018 80-112 loss to SAS. He shot 1-7 from the field and 0-3 from three. His plus-minus was -18.
